Designing Your Living Space with Purpose
Your living room sets the tone for your entire home, making it worth investing time into getting right. Start by defining the primary function of the space—whether that is entertaining guests, relaxing after work, or working remotely. Choose furniture that supports these activities without overwhelming the room.
For smaller DC apartments common in historic buildings, consider multi-functional pieces like a storage ottoman or a sofa bed. Light colors and mirrors can make compact spaces feel more open, while warm lighting fixtures add coziness during darker winter months. Layer your textures with throw pillows, area rugs, and curtains to create visual depth without clutter.
When styling walls, think beyond traditional art arrangements. Gallery walls work beautifully in apartments for rent in dc where you may not want permanent installations. Removable wallpaper is another excellent option for adding personality without committing to a long-term change.
Bedroom Retreats for Restful Nights
Your bedroom should serve as a sanctuary away from the hustle of DC life. Invest in quality bedding with breathable fabrics that keep you comfortable year-round. The District experiences humid summers and chilly winters, so versatile layers are essential.
Consider how natural light flows through your windows and dress them accordingly. Sheer curtains allow soft morning light while heavier drapes provide privacy and insulation during evening hours. Add bedside lamps on both sides of the bed for balanced lighting and convenience.
Organization matters in bedrooms too. A well-arranged closet with uniform hangers and labeled bins keeps clothing accessible and visually pleasing. Nightstands should hold only essentials to maintain a calm, uncluttered feel that promotes restful sleep.
Kitchen Style Meets Functionality
The kitchen often becomes the heart of your apartment, especially in open-concept layouts popular in newer DC developments. Even compact kitchens benefit from smart styling choices that maximize both form and function.
Open shelving displays beautiful dishware while keeping frequently used items within reach. A well-chosen backsplash can transform a basic kitchen into something special without requiring major renovation. Consider peel-and-stick options for renters who want style without permanent changes.
Countertop appliances like coffee makers and toasters should complement your overall aesthetic. Choose finishes that coordinate with your hardware—brushed nickel, matte black, or brass all offer different vibes depending on your design direction.
Bringing Nature Indoors
Plants are one of the most affordable ways to add life and color to any apartment for rent in dc. They purify air, reduce stress, and create a connection to nature even when you live in an urban setting. Snake plants, pothos, and peace lilies thrive in typical DC apartment conditions with moderate light.
Group plants together on shelves or tables to create a mini indoor garden effect. Hanging planters work well in kitchens where floor space is limited. For those without green thumbs, low-maintenance options like succulents and cacti offer beauty with minimal effort.

What are the best DC neighborhoods for apartment living?
Capitol Hill offers a walkable community with excellent restaurants and parks. Dupont Circle provides a mix of historic charm and modern amenities. Georgetown appeals to those who enjoy boutique shopping and waterfront views. NoMa and Shaw have emerged as trendy areas with new developments.
How can I decorate a small DC apartment on a budget?
Focus on high-impact changes first like fresh paint, new lighting, and strategic furniture placement. Thrift stores and online marketplaces offer affordable pieces that can be refreshed with paint or new hardware. Renters should prioritize removable solutions like peel-and-stick wallpaper and adhesive hooks.
What is the ideal rent range for apartments in DC?
Rent varies significantly by neighborhood. Studio apartments typically range from $1,400 to $2,200 monthly. One-bedroom units generally fall between $1,600 and $2,800 depending on location and amenities. Luxury buildings with concierge services and rooftop decks command premium rates.
Should I rent furnished or unfurnished apartments in DC?
Furnished apartments are ideal for short-term stays or professionals relocating from out of town. Unfurnished spaces give you full control over your style and long-term investment. Consider how long you plan to stay and whether buying furniture would be more cost-effective over time.
How do I find apartments for rent in dc that allow pets?
Many newer apartment buildings welcome pets with specific breed and weight restrictions. Look for properties that mention pet amenities like dog parks or washing stations on their listings. Older walk-ups may have stricter policies, so always confirm details before signing your lease.
